#bcfc4d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bcfc4d is composed of 73.7% red, 98.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 81.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 64.5%. #bcfc4d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#79f900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#bcfc4d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bcfc4d has RGB values of R:188, G:252,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 12385357.

Shades and Tints of #bcfc4d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0f00 is the darkest color, while #fdfffb is the lightest one.
